Marin Cilic is another player who hasn’t done justice to his talent. The Croatian was the runner-up in the last edition of Wimbledon as the 30-year-old lost his way in that game because of an injury. This year too he was a runner-up at the Australian Open as he lost to Roger Federer in the final. Cilic also won the Queens Club Championships before the Wimbledon tournament.

The 2014 US Open champion has stated that winning the Shanghai Masters tournament will give him a much-required boost to do well in the upcoming tournaments and the Grand Slam tournaments next year. Cilic is seeded 6th in Shanghai and has stated that doing well there will help him improve his rankings.

His sublime baseline strokes have always unsettled his opponents, combined with his powerful groundstrokes. Cilic has the ability to produce some brilliant groundstrokes during the run of play which can outclass his rivals. He can also execute some exceptional drop shots. Cilic can also cover a lot of ground with his reach and quick moves.
